How to start online business with zero-experience

Introduction

Starting an online business might sound intimidating—especially if you have no background in entrepreneurship, marketing, or tech. The good news is that today, launching a digital business doesn’t require advanced skills or a huge budget. With the right mindset, tools, and step-by-step approach, anyone can build an online business from scratch.

In this guide, I’ll walk you through exactly how to start—even if you’re starting at zero.


Step 1: Shift Your Mindset

Before you think about websites or products, remember: successful entrepreneurs start as beginners. Don’t wait to feel “ready.” Instead, start small, learn along the way, and accept mistakes as part of the journey.

Pro Tip: Focus on progress over perfection. Every small step forward compounds into big results.


Step 2: Pick a Simple Business Model

You don’t need to reinvent the wheel. Instead, choose from proven online business models that are beginner-friendly:

  • Freelancing: Sell your skills (writing, design, coding, etc.) on platforms like Upwork or Fiverr.
  • Dropshipping: Sell products without holding inventory—partner with suppliers who handle shipping.
  • Digital Products: Create and sell eBooks, templates, or courses.
  • Affiliate Marketing: Recommend products and earn commission when people buy through your links.

Step 3: Validate Your Idea

Before investing time and money, make sure people want what you’re offering.

  • Search forums like Reddit or Quora to see if people ask about your topic.
  • Use Google Trends to check interest levels.
  • Look at competitors—if they’re selling, there’s demand.

Step 4: Build a Simple Online Presence

You don’t need a complex website to start. Begin with:

  • A one-page WordPress site (use free themes like Astra or GeneratePress).
  • Social media presence (choose 1-2 platforms your audience uses most).
  • An email list (use free tools like Mailchimp or Brevo to collect emails).

Step 5: Learn Basic Marketing

Even the best business won’t grow without visibility. Focus on:

  • Content marketing: Write blog posts, record short videos, or create infographics.
  • Social proof: Collect testimonials, reviews, and share customer success stories.
  • Paid ads (optional): Start small with Facebook or Google Ads once you understand your audience.

Step 6: Start Small & Scale Up

Don’t overcomplicate your launch. Sell one product or service, learn what works, and gradually expand. Reinvest profits into better tools, ads, and outsourcing tasks.


Conclusion

You don’t need experience to start an online business—you just need persistence, a simple business model, and a willingness to learn. Start small, validate your ideas, and build step by step. The digital world rewards action, not hesitation.